Division 229 · 3 May 2023
National Security Bill: motion to disagree with Lords Amendment 122
At a glance
This division passed on 3 May 2023 by a margin of 118, with 254 Ayes and 136 Noes. The largest Aye bloc was Conservative with 241 votes. The largest No bloc was Labour with 79 votes. There were 2 rebel votes — MPs voting against their party's majority. The 248 MPs who did not vote outnumbered the margin — enough to have changed the result. This motion was proposed by The Minister for Security. This division took place during a debate on National Security Bill. This division is linked to the National Security Act 2023 (Government Bill).

What is a Commons division?
A Commons division is a recorded vote in the House of Commons where MPs are recorded as voting Aye or No. Source
